The Missouri State Highway Patrol just added some new frequencies, however the PSR-500 can not montior them.

The new frequencies are :

SG WQDT268
MISSOURI, STATE OF
[The Missouri State Highway Patrol is the largest statewide law enforcement agency with responsibilities throughout Missouri.]
Control Point 1 - Missouri State Highway Patrol General Headquarters 1510 East Elm, Jefferson City MO 573-751-3747

(link)
12/12/2008 License Modified
1 - MO Statewide
769.0563 MOI 2e 8K10F1E 11K2F3E
769.0687 MOI 2e 8K10F1E 11K2F3E

774.9938 MOI 2e 8K10F1E 11K2F3E
804.9938 MOI 2e 8K10F1E 11K2F3E
799.0563 MOI 2e 8K10F1E 11K2F3E
799.0687 MOI 2e 8K10F1E 11K2F3E

So will there be a fix for these, there are two problems. 1) the steps, and 2 the last few frequencies the scanner does not accept in its band scope.

Can or will this be fixed?

That scanner will still hear them. Example, for 769.05625 tune your scanner to 769.055. Because these two frqs are just 0.00125 MHz apart, the difference is so small the scanner will still receive it perfectly.

Is there a difference in how the PSR600 and 500 program? I thought they were the same radio inside.
On my PSR-600 these frequencies program so close you would never know you were off. They program up as follows:
804.9938 programs as 804.993750
799.0563 programs as 799.056250
799.0687 programs as 799.068750
These are only 50 Hz off frequency and most likely you scanner PLL is off more than that.

On a PSR-500 with the latest firmware, the 769 and 774 frequencies program just fine; the 799 and 804 frequencies do not.

I do recognize that most people would never hear anything on these frequencies because they are never that close to "the action." However, he is right that at least some of those frequencies cannot be programmed into a PSR-500.

799 and 804 used to be programmable. The latest firmware upgrade removed them. I don't think they received correctly, though, at least they didn't on my radio.
